Understanding Lawyer Doc Management Systems: The Basics
Lawyer Doc Management Systems, or LDMS, represent a critical advancement in the legal sector, offering efficient and secure methods to handle the vast volume of documentation that law offices process daily. At their core, these systems streamline document creation, storage, retrieval, and distribution, thereby enhancing productivity and ensuring compliance with legal and regulatory standards. The basic functionality of an LDMS involves digitalizing documents, organizing them into structured folders, and implementing robust security protocols to protect sensitive client information.
An LDMS operates as a centralized repository, eliminating the need for physical filing cabinets and reducing the risk of document loss or damage. Lawyers and their support staff can access, edit, and share documents from any location, enabling seamless collaboration and efficient case management. For instance, a study by the American Bar Association (ABA) found that law offices that adopted cloud-based LDMS reported a 25% increase in document retrieval speed and a 30% reduction in time spent locating vital case files. This not only improves workflow efficiency but also saves on valuable law office equipment and physical storage space.
Moreover, LDMS systems incorporate advanced features like version control, audit trails, and automated metadata tagging, which facilitate accurate tracking of document revisions and usage. This data-driven approach allows legal professionals to gain valuable insights into document workflows, identify inefficiencies, and make informed strategic decisions. For example, metadata tagging can help pinpoint the most frequently accessed documents, enabling law offices to allocate resources more effectively and enhance client service delivery. Choosing the Right Law Office Equipment for Efficient Management
Choosing the right law office equipment is a strategic decision that significantly impacts the efficiency and productivity of legal practices. In an industry where precision and organization are paramount, efficient management systems become the cornerstone of successful law offices. The right tools can streamline workflows, enhance client interactions, and foster a culture of accuracy and compliance.
Consider the impact of digital transformation on law offices. Modern law office equipment, such as document management systems (DMS), has revolutionized how legal professionals handle and organize cases. For instance, a robust DMS enables secure storage, rapid retrieval, and seamless sharing of documents, replacing clunky paper-based systems. This transition not only saves time but also reduces the risk of document loss or damage, enhancing overall efficiency. According to a recent study, law firms that adopted cloud-based DMS reported a 25% increase in document accessibility and a 15% reduction in administrative tasks related to document management.
Furthermore, integrating technology like advanced scanners, optical character recognition (OCR) software, and smart printers can automate document processing, ensuring accuracy and consistency. These innovations minimize errors and save attorneys and support staff valuable time. For example, OCR technology can convert scanned documents into editable, searchable formats, facilitating quick reviews and edits. Implementing Digital Solutions: Streamlining Legal Document Workflows
In today’s digital era, law offices are increasingly recognizing the benefits of implementing digital solutions to streamline legal document workflows. This transition from traditional paper-based systems to electronic document management (EDM) is not merely a matter of convenience; it’s a strategic move to enhance efficiency, reduce costs, and improve client service. By adopting advanced legal document management systems (LDMS), law offices can automate repetitive tasks, facilitate secure sharing, and ensure easy retrieval of critical information.
For instance, a study by the American Bar Association (ABA) found that law offices that have adopted digital solutions reported a 25% increase in overall productivity. This boost in efficiency comes from features like automatic indexing, version control, and built-in templates, which replace manual data entry and document drafting tasks. Moreover, digital systems enable real-time collaboration, allowing multiple lawyers and support staff to work simultaneously on the same document, enhancing teamwork and reducing turnaround times.
One of the most significant advantages of digital document management is the enhanced security it offers. Encryption, access controls, and audit trails ensure that sensitive client information remains protected. For example, a law office specializing in intellectual property cases can use digital systems to securely store and manage patent applications, preventing unauthorized access and potential data breaches. This is particularly crucial in light of recent regulations like GDPR, which mandate strict data protection measures.
Implementing digital solutions also calls for a strategic approach to law office equipment. While purchasing new software, consider the compatibility with existing infrastructure and the training needs of staff. Customized solutions that integrate seamlessly with legal research tools, case management software, and e-discovery platforms can offer a comprehensive workflow management system. Regular reviews and updates ensure that the technology remains aligned with the evolving needs of the legal practice. Best Practices for Secure and Effective Legal Document Storage
In the digital age, secure and effective legal document storage has become a cornerstone of successful law offices. Best practices for managing documents go beyond mere digital conversion; they encompass a comprehensive strategy that ensures accessibility, security, and compliance. A robust lawyer doc management system (LDMS) acts as the linchpin, integrating seamlessly with existing law office equipment to streamline workflows and mitigate risks.
Centralized digital repositories, for instance, replace disorganized physical files, enhancing document retrieval and reducing the risks associated with paper decay. Encryption, access controls, and audit trails are non-negotiable features in a high-stakes legal environment. For example, a study by the American Bar Association revealed that 44% of law firms experienced data breaches in the past two years, underscoring the critical need for robust security measures. An LDMS that incorporates these features not only safeguards sensitive client information but also builds trust and maintains professional integrity.
Moreover, automation plays a pivotal role in efficient document management. Intelligent document routing, electronic signatures, and automated workflows reduce manual intervention, minimizing errors and expediting processes. Consider a system that allows for automated document generation and approval, aligning perfectly with the legal profession’s need for speed and precision.
